☐ Key ceremony item 7 — Payroll export format change (Ledgerbrook). Before the new column layout goes live, the signing key for the export pipeline must be rotated. New team members: attend with your witness partner, confirm the old key is revoked in the registry, and verify a sample export validates against the v3 schema. Record both serial numbers in the ceremony log. When the custodian prompts you, read out the recovery passphrase shown directly below.

vault phrase of hahop-badug = novvan-ulaion-zorius-noviel-gorwyn-casix-tamys

To the release manager: I'm passing ownership of the Pellwick deep-link router to Sorrel before the 4.2 cut. The intent-matching table now lives in the Farrowgate config service; stale entries were purged last sprint. Watch the fallback route — it silently swallows malformed slugs, which inflated our drop-off metrics in March. The staging resolver needs its keystore unlocked before each regression pass, and that keystore accepts only one credential. For the signing vault, the recovery phrase is noted directly below.

recovery phrase for tafog-fafog: novix-novdor-fraath-brieth-olieth-oliix-rusix-wenion-julax-druox

**Internal Memo — Arclight Foundry Group**

Heads of department: we have received a term sheet from our partner Novarre Holdings covering the proposed joint venture on the Caldus platform. Key points: 60/40 equity split in their favour, a three-year exclusivity clause, and staged capital contributions. Counsel has flagged the termination provisions as unusually one-sided, and Helena Voss is preparing a counter. Please review carefully before Thursday. The confidential note below states our position.

confidential, kagup-bafog: Fraaxax Group is in early talks to buy Soroxox Group for about $343.8 million. The Olidor launch date is June 14, and nothing goes to the press before then. Legal wants the Aldmirek Logistics term sheet signed before July 23.